Ellie released her debut studio album, Lights, on Polydor Records on 1st March 2010. The album was recieved well by critics, and was highly anticipated after Ellie won the Critics’ Choice Brit Award.
The album debuted at number 1 in the UK Albums Chart, selling 40,000 copies in the first week. It dropped to number 16 the week after and remained in the charts until late October 2010.
In late 2010, Lights was re-released in the United Kingdom under the name Bright Lights. After its release on 29th November, it re-entered the album charts at number 24. It was the 24th best selling album in the UK, with sales at around 387,600 copies.
Lights was released in America on the 8th March, with a modified tracklist, and debuted at 129 on the Billboard 200. The album peaked at 76 on 28th May after a series of performances in America, including a live performance on Saturday Night Live.
Six singles have been released from the album in the United Kingdom: Under the Sheets, Starry Eyed, Guns and Horses, The Writer, Your Song and the title-track, Lights.
After Ellie was chosen to perform for Prince William and Catherine Middleton’s wedding, the album returned to the top 10 in the album charts.

Ellie, born in Hereford, is probably best known for her number four hit 'Starry Eyed' and her cover of Elton John's 'Your Song'. She topped the BBC Sound of 2010 poll, and won the 2010 Critics' Choice Brit Award. After that her year just got better, with her debut album going straight in at number one. Ellie performed at most of the festivals in the summer of 2010, including Glastonbury! Her final single of 2010, 'Your Song', peaked at number two in the UK Top 40 and 2011 was another great year for Ellie, who released her debut album in America in March and performed at Coachella festival. Ellie was also chosen to play for the royal couple (William and Kate) at their after party to their wedding in April, and even appeared on Saturday Night Live with Tina Fey.
